The National Museum of Yaounde

If you are a lover of history and culture, then the National Museum of Yaounde should definitely be on your itinerary. The museum is home to a vast collection of art, cultural artifacts, and other historical relics that date back to the pre-colonial era of Cameroon.Visitors can expect to see an extensive collection of ethnic musical instruments, ancient traditional clothing, as well as photographs that document both the colonial period and independence era. The museum’s most prized possessions are the masks and statues that represent traditional African art.

The Reunification Monument

Located at the heart of Yaounde, the Reunification Monument is one of the city’s most popular landmarks. The monument symbolizes the reunification of Southern Cameroon and the Republic of Cameroon in 1961.The statues depict the embodiment of the reunification, and visitors can take pictures with them. The monument sits on a roundabout, which is busy with both vehicular and pedestrian traffic. Locals and tourists alike visit the area to appreciate this significant symbol of African Unity.

The Mefou National Park

The Mefou National Park is situated just a few kilometers away from Yaounde, and it features a tropical forest, home to gorillas and chimpanzees, as well as a variety of other animals that roam free in the park’s green landscape.Visitors can take a guided tour of the park to observe these beautiful creatures up close, learning about their habits and behavior from expert guides. The park aims to promote environmental conservation and awareness to young people in Cameroon.

Dining Spots

Yaounde is known for its rich cuisine, and you should not leave the city without experiencing some of these famous dishes:

1. Ndolè: This is a stew made with a spinach-like vegetable called ndole, peanuts, and meat or fish. It’s a specialty of the city and is a must-try during your visit.

2. Achu: This is a Cameroonian dish made with pounded cocoyam and served with soup and meat. It’s a dish that’s prepared for special occasions and is a perfect example of traditional Cameroonian cuisine.
